The MAX4488AUA+ from Maxim Integrated is a high-performance, low-noise operational amplifier designed to deliver precision and power efficiency for a wide range of applications. This op-amp features a unity-gain stable, quad operational amplifier configuration, making it ideal for applications that require multiple amplification stages or signal conditioning blocks.
Key Features
- Low Noise Performance: The MAX4488AUA+ is engineered to offer low voltage noise density, which makes it suitable for audio applications and signal processing where noise can be a critical factor.
- Power Efficiency: With its low supply current, the device is optimized for power-sensitive applications, ensuring minimal power consumption without sacrificing performance.
- Wide Supply Range: The operational amplifier operates over a broad supply voltage range, accommodating various system design requirements and simplifying power supply design.
- High Output Drive Capability: The device can drive heavy loads while maintaining excellent linearity, which is crucial for driving ADCs or other high-impedance loads.
- Stable Operation: The MAX4488AUA+ is designed for stability with capacitive loads, ensuring reliable performance in a variety of circuit configurations.
